Responsible for the setup, conversion, calibration, repair, preventive, and predictive maintenance of automated test handlers used for Final Test, Wafer sort and Tape and Reel manufacturing processes. These include automated test handlers' sub-assemblies and related components or parts. Responsible for first-level verification of Yield and QA failures in manufacturing. Tasks include troubleshooting setups, performing basic tester debugging, and documenting through the MIPS process. Involves collaboration with manufacturing and engineering, submission of performance reports, and participation in efficiency and quality improvement programs aligned with TQM Plus principles.

Key Qualifications:

  • Must have basic knowledge of electronic circuits, ability to interpret schematic diagrams, and familiarity with test equipment setup and operation
  • Can operate the equipment
  • Performs simple setups and conversion.

Education and Experience:

  • Graduate of Electronics Technology, Mechanical Technology, Electro-Mechanical Technology, or any related vocational course.
  • Fresh graduate or with at least 1 year work experience in electronics or semiconductor industry.
